Graduation rates for West Virginia University Institute of Technology
Years Percent Earning Bachelor's Degree
within 4 years 9% earned a bachelor degree
within 5 years 23% earned a bachelor degree
within 6 years 29% earned a bachelor degree

A college's graduation rate is a strong indication of its effectiveness and your potential to find success at a school. These statistics measure the percentage of first-time, full-time students who earned a bachelor degree within four, five or six years from West Virginia University Institute of Technology. For comparison, approximately 58% of starting students nationally earn a bachelor's degree within six years. West Virginia University Institute of Technology is less effective than average in terms of graduating students.

Average salary after attending West Virginia University Institute of Technology
Years Average Earnings
after 6 years $38,000 per year
after 7 years $41,000 per year
after 8 years $44,700 per year
after 9 years $47,400 per year
after 10 years $50,600 per year

10 years after enrolling, the average income of former West Virginia University Institute of Technology students who are working and no longer in school is $50,600, which is 48% higher than the national median.
